When you’re running a laser level on a bright site and the beam basically disappears, that’s where the Stanley FATMAX LD200 Laser Line Detector earns its keep. It’s built to pick up pulsed laser lines that your eye just can’t see — indoors or outside — and guide you right onto level using a clear LCD display with audible alerts. Here’s the thing: once you’ve used a detector like this on a big layout job, you won’t want to go back to guessing.
The unit is designed for trade use, not DIY shelf life. With a working range up to roughly 50-metre detection distance and millimetre-level accuracy, it lets you stretch your laser setup across long corridors, exterior slabs, or multi-room fit-outs without losing reference. And since it runs on simple AAA battery power, you’re not hunting for special chargers halfway through the day — swap and keep moving. That matters a lot on a job site.

Technical Specifications Explained
- Detection Range (up to ~50 m) - Gives enough reach for most building interiors, commercial spaces, and many exterior leveling jobs.
- Accuracy (approx. ±1–1.5 mm) - Tight tolerance helps prevent cumulative layout errors when setting heights or lines.
- Power Source (AAA batteries) - Easy field replacement means less downtime compared with built-in rechargeable packs.
- LCD Display + Audio Signal - Provides both visual readout and beeps so you can track level without staring constantly at the screen.
- IP-rated Dust/Water Resistance - Designed to handle dusty construction zones and occasional wet conditions without failing.
